Medicare is health insurance for people 65 and older. It also covers younger people with certain disabilities. It helps pay for doctor visits and hospital stays. We can tell you more about what Medicare covers.
Medicare generally doesn't cover routine dental care, eye exams for glasses, hearing aids, cosmetic surgery, long-term care, or most alternative therapies. Understanding these limits is key. We can help clarify these exclusions for you.
The main requirements are U.S. citizenship or legal residency. You also need to be 65 or older. Or, you need to have a qualifying disability. We can help you confirm you meet these requirements.
